#include <string.h>
#include "dsd.h"
#include "dsd_nocarrier.h"
void liveScanner(dsd_opts * opts, dsd_state * state)
{
#ifdef USE_PORTAUDIO
if(opts->audio_in_type == 2)
{
PaError err = Pa_StartStream( opts->audio_in_pa_stream );
if( err != paNoError )
{
fprintf( stderr, "An error occured while starting the portaudio input stream\n" );
fprintf( stderr, "Error number: %d\n", err );
fprintf( stderr, "Error message: %s\n", Pa_GetErrorText( err ) );
return;
}
}
#endif
while (1)
{
noCarrier(opts, state);
state->synctype = getFrameSync(opts, state);
// recalibrate center/umid/lmid
state->center = ((state->max) + (state->min)) / 2;
state->umid = (((state->max) - state->center) * 5 / 8) + state->center;
state->lmid = (((state->min) - state->center) * 5 / 8) + state->center;
while (state->synctype != -1)
{
processFrame(opts, state);
#ifdef TRACE_DSD
state->debug_prefix = 'S';
#endif
state->synctype = getFrameSync(opts, state);
#ifdef TRACE_DSD
state->debug_prefix = '\0';
#endif
// recalibrate center/umid/lmid
state->center = ((state->max) + (state->min)) / 2;
state->umid = (((state->max) - state->center) * 5 / 8)
+ state->center;
state->lmid = (((state->min) - state->center) * 5 / 8)
+ state->center;
}
}
}
